
Cobra Kai has badass Nielsen stats.
As most of you already know, Cobra Kai is about being badass. So, it’s only fitting that it’s starting figures on Netflix are badass. Seriously, they are quite a sight to behold, especially for a show that’s been around for years on YouTube Premium. According to Yahoo!, Cobra Kai is the No. 2 series on Nielsen’s Top SVOD rankings for the week of August 24! But this doesn’t even take into account that it only includes three days of it being available.
Cobra Kai’s more specific numbers are even more badass than its ranking. For those three days, it took in 1.4 billion minutes. For reference, the show itself is only 577 minutes in length between its two seasons. This means the watch time — in three days — was the equivalent of over 2.4 million viewers watching both seasons in their entirety. That’s right, I did the math.

Sadly, they came second to Lucifer, but as I said before, this only accounted for a few days with Cobra Kai being on the service. And in the time since then, I couldn’t help but notice all the buzz surrounding the show. While It’s always had a great reception from fans, the show’s release on Netflix has only amplified the positive vibes I was already seeing online.
